Code P1212 Cadillac Description

The P1212 diagnostic trouble code (DTC) in a Cadillac indicates a problem with the Mass Air Flow (MAF) sensor circuit that is intermittently reading lower than expected. The MAF sensor is a crucial component of the vehicle's engine management system, responsible for measuring the amount of air entering the engine. This information is used by the engine control module (ECM) to calculate the correct air/fuel mixture for optimal combustion and performance.

Common Causes of P1212 Cadillac

  1. Dirty or faulty MAF sensor
  2. Loose or corroded MAF sensor wiring/connectors
  3. Air intake system leaks
  4. Vacuum leaks in the intake system
  5. Faulty ECM

Symptoms of P1212 Cadillac

  1. Check Engine Light illuminated
  2. Rough idling or stalling
  3. Reduced power or acceleration
  4. Poor fuel efficiency
  5. Engine hesitation or misfiring

How to Fix P1212 Cadillac

  1. Begin by performing a visual inspection of the MAF sensor, wiring, and connectors. Clean any dirt or debris that may be affecting the sensor's performance.
  2. Use a multimeter to test the MAF sensor's voltage output and resistance to determine if it is functioning correctly.
  3. Check for any air leaks in the intake system, including hoses, gaskets, and intake manifold. Repair or replace any damaged components.
  4. Inspect and test the ECM to ensure it is sending and receiving signals properly. Replace if necessary.
  5. Clear the DTC and reset the ECM to see if the issue has been resolved. Test drive the vehicle to confirm that the symptoms have been eliminated.

Cost to Fix P1212 Cadillac

The typical repair costs for addressing a P1212 DTC in a Cadillac can range from $100 to $500, depending on the specific cause of the issue and the required repairs. This estimate includes the cost of parts such as a new MAF sensor, wiring harness, or ECM, as well as labor charges for diagnosis and repair. It's important to note that labor rates can vary between different auto repair shops, so it's recommended to obtain quotes from multiple sources to ensure a competitive price. Additionally, the cost may be higher if additional issues are discovered during the diagnosis and repair process.
